Biography

Edith Maud Pearson

Born: 6 January 1897, Chelmsford 

Father: Luke Edward Pearson (b. 1859)

Mother: Eveline Eliza Pearson (b. 1869)

Sisters: Eveline S Pearson (b. 1892), Ethel Charlotte Pearson (b. 1894), Enid Dorothy Pearson (b. 1911)

In 1901 – 

She is at Park Lane, Ramsden Bellhouse, Billericay. Her father is listed as ‘Stockman on Farm’. Edith, her mother and sisters, Eveline and Ethel, are unlisted. 

In 1911 –  

She is at Stoke Coventry, Stoke. Her father is listed as ‘Farm Bailiff’. Her sister, Ethel, is listed as ‘Office Clerk’. Edith and her mother are unlisted. 

In 10/17 – 

At Balsall St. Council, Coventry and Wellesbourne C. of E.

Qualification: Camb. Senior 1917.

In 05/20 –

Appointed to Ilford Hall High School.

In 1921 – 

She is at Wornlughton Hill, Wormleighton. Her father is listed as ‘Assistant General Farm Work’. Her mother and sister, Enid, are unlisted. Her sister, Eveline, is listed as ‘Uncertificated Elementary School Teacher’. Edith is listed as ‘Certificated Elementary School Teacher’. 

In 1939 – 

She is at School House Whitechurch, Canonicorum, Bridford, Dorset. Edith is listed as ‘Elementary School Mistress’. 

d.         7 October 1966, Weymouth

PEARSON, Edith Maud of School House, Salway Ash, Bridport, Dorset died 7 October 1966 at Dorset County Hospital, Dorchester. Probate Birmingham 28 December to Enid Dorothy Pearson, spinster. £164
